Job Description

Mental Health Counselor / Social Worker Research Associate Location: Hybrid (part‑time, 15 hours per week) with travel up to 4 days per week within 1.25 hours of Providence, RI. Reports to: Principal Investigator, Hassenfeld Institute. Key Responsibilities Engage in the Mood Check school screening project, traveling to schools in Rhode Island and Massachusetts to deliver educational sessions and conduct follow‑up assessments with adolescents who report symptoms of depression. Conduct research screenings, clinical assessments, follow‑up interviews, and motivational interviews in English and Spanish with study participants and their parents or guardians. Serve as a culturally and linguistically appropriate liaison between students, families, school personnel, and the research team to meet program objectives. Provide periodic evening clinical coverage for the study team as needed. Qualifications Master’s degree in Counseling, Social Work, Psychology, or a related field. 2‑5 years of clinical experience and current independent licensure as a mental health counselor (LMHC) or clinical social worker (LCSW) licensed in Rhode Island. Willingness to apply for Massachusetts licensure upon request. Proficiency in English and Spanish, with demonstrated ability to conduct clinical interviews and documentation in both languages. Experience working with children and adolescents in school or clinical settings. Job Competencies Engage professionally with students and families in Spanish‑speaking educational environments. Document clinical observations and assessment findings in English based on interviews conducted in Spanish. Conduct outreach and follow‑up calls in Spanish to engage families in the screening and referral process. Serve as a linguistic bridge between the research team and Spanish‑speaking community stakeholders to facilitate project goals and participant retention. Exhibit strong communication skills, both written and verbal, even under short deadlines. Maintain strong interpersonal skills and develop relationships with diverse partners. Demonstrate technical clinical skills and complete documentation in REDCap, a secure web‑based database compliant with HIPAA and FERPA. Accurately write and report analyses and reviews. Be observant, self‑motivated, and able to think critically and problem‑solve while managing time effectively. Possess a valid driver’s license and access to a reliable vehicle for travel to off‑site locations.
